当前位置:首页 > 综合资讯 > 正文
广告招租
游戏推广

对象存储开源软件有哪些,盘点当前主流的对象存储开源软件及其特点与应用

对象存储开源软件有哪些,盘点当前主流的对象存储开源软件及其特点与应用

主流对象存储开源软件包括Ceph、OpenStack Swift、MinIO、Rclone等。Ceph支持大规模存储集群,适用于云平台;Swift为OpenStack提...

主流对象存储开源软件包括Ceph、OpenStack Swift、MinIO、Rclone等。Ceph支持大规模存储集群,适用于云平台;Swift为OpenStack提供对象存储服务,支持高并发;MinIO轻量级,易于部署;Rclone跨平台,支持多种存储服务。

随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足日益增长的数据存储需求,对象存储作为一种新型的存储技术,因其高扩展性、高可用性和低成本等优势,在云存储领域得到了广泛应用,本文将为您盘点当前主流的对象存储开源软件,并分析其特点与应用。

主流对象存储开源软件

1、OpenStack Swift

OpenStack Swift是由OpenStack基金会开发的一个开源对象存储系统,具有高可用性、高扩展性、易部署等特点,Swift支持多种编程语言,如Python、Java、Go等,可方便地与其他OpenStack组件集成。

特点:

(1)高可用性:Swift采用分布式存储架构,节点之间相互独立,即使部分节点故障,也不会影响整个系统的正常运行。

对象存储开源软件有哪些,盘点当前主流的对象存储开源软件及其特点与应用

(2)高扩展性:Swift支持水平扩展,可轻松应对海量数据存储需求。

(3)易部署:Swift采用模块化设计,可快速部署和扩展。

应用:

(1)企业级云存储:Swift广泛应用于企业级云存储,如OpenStack对象存储服务。

(2)个人云存储:Swift可用于个人云存储,如UCloud、七牛云等。

2、Ceph

Ceph是一个开源的分布式存储系统,由Sage Weil创建,Ceph具有高可用性、高扩展性、高性能等特点,支持对象、块和文件存储。

特点:

(1)高可用性:Ceph采用分布式存储架构,节点之间相互独立,即使部分节点故障,也不会影响整个系统的正常运行。

(2)高扩展性:Ceph支持水平扩展,可轻松应对海量数据存储需求。

(3)高性能:Ceph采用多路径I/O,提高了数据读写速度。

应用:

对象存储开源软件有哪些,盘点当前主流的对象存储开源软件及其特点与应用

(1)数据中心存储:Ceph广泛应用于数据中心存储,如AWS、腾讯云等。

(2)云计算平台:Ceph可用于云计算平台,如OpenStack、Kubernetes等。

3、MinIO

MinIO是一个开源的分布式对象存储系统,基于Go语言开发,MinIO具有高可用性、高扩展性、易部署等特点,适用于边缘计算、云存储和大数据场景。

特点:

(1)高可用性:MinIO采用分布式存储架构,节点之间相互独立,即使部分节点故障,也不会影响整个系统的正常运行。

(2)高扩展性:MinIO支持水平扩展,可轻松应对海量数据存储需求。

(3)易部署:MinIO采用模块化设计,可快速部署和扩展。

应用:

(1)边缘计算:MinIO适用于边缘计算场景,如物联网、智能城市等。

(2)云存储:MinIO可用于云存储,如阿里云、腾讯云等。

4、Seagate Kinetic

对象存储开源软件有哪些,盘点当前主流的对象存储开源软件及其特点与应用

Seagate Kinetic是一个基于对象存储的开源存储系统,采用分布式存储架构,Kinetic具有高可用性、高扩展性、低延迟等特点,适用于大规模数据存储场景。

特点:

(1)高可用性:Kinetic采用分布式存储架构,节点之间相互独立,即使部分节点故障,也不会影响整个系统的正常运行。

(2)高扩展性:Kinetic支持水平扩展,可轻松应对海量数据存储需求。

(3)低延迟:Kinetic采用异步I/O,降低了数据读写延迟。

应用:

(1)大规模数据存储:Kinetic适用于大规模数据存储场景,如数据中心、云存储等。

(2)分布式系统:Kinetic可用于分布式系统,如分布式数据库、分布式缓存等。

随着数据量的不断增长,对象存储技术逐渐成为云存储领域的主流,本文为您介绍了当前主流的对象存储开源软件,包括OpenStack Swift、Ceph、MinIO和Seagate Kinetic等,这些开源软件具有高可用性、高扩展性、易部署等特点,适用于不同场景的数据存储需求,在选购对象存储开源软件时,应根据实际需求进行选择,以满足企业或个人在数据存储方面的需求。

广告招租
游戏推广

发表评论

最新文章